Costs of Obtaining a Driver's License in Poland
The process of obtaining a driver's license in Poland is detailed, involving both theoretical and useful tests. Below is an in-depth breakdown of expenses associated with getting a Polish driver's license:
| Item | Cost (PLN) |
|---|---|
| Driving School Fees | 3,000 - 4,500 |
| Theory Test Fee | 30-- 200 |
| Practical Test Fee | 150-- 300 |
| Medical exam | 100-- 200 |
| License Issuance Fee | 100 |
| Total Estimated Cost | 3,380 - 5,300 |
Keep in mind: Fees might vary depending on the driving school's area and reputation.

House Permit Costs
For non-EU citizens, obtaining a house permit is vital for living and working in Poland. The following breakdown describes the costs involved:
| Item | Cost (PLN) |
|---|---|
| Application Fee | 340-- 1,000 |
| Document Preparation Costs | 100-- 500 |
| Legal Assistance Fee | 300-- 1,000 |
| Medical Insurance | 100-- 300 |
| Total Estimated Cost | 840 - 2,800 |
